Mission Critical: Reshaping news librarianship for the 21st Century
In this seminar, participants will focus on leadership issues relevant to their role and the role of the news research team in the newsroom. You'll discuss integrating the news research team into the daily workflow of the newsroom, providing services that are truly mission critical, and abandoning those which have outlived their usefulness. You will focus on developing a vision for news research and consider how well your team can carry out this vision. You will get tips and learn best practices ideas to help you increase your relevance. Participants will bring a management challenge to the group and develop an action plan to resolve it. You'll consider your personal leadership style and learn effective strategies for working more effectively with bosses and fellow department heads. Seminar is targeted for emerging leaders and new managers.

The workshop will take place from April 10 - April 13, 2005 in St. Petersburg, Florida.
